1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is motion?

Back

Motion is the change in position of an object over time.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a motion graph?

Back

A motion graph visually represents the position, velocity, or acceleration of an object over time.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does a horizontal line on a motion graph indicate?

Back

A horizontal line indicates that the object is stationary.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does a straight diagonal line on a motion graph represent?

Back

A straight diagonal line represents constant velocity.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does a curved line on a motion graph indicate?

Back

A curved line indicates that the object is accelerating or decelerating.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is acceleration?

Back

Acceleration is the rate of change of velocity of an object.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for calculating distance?

Back

Distance = Speed × Time.
